How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Nashville?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Nashville Studio Apartments | $718 | $608 | $849 |
Nashville 1 Bedroom Apartments | $884 | $615 | $1,596 |
Nashville 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,074 | $660 | $2,077 |
Nashville 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,307 | $925 | $2,364 |
Nashville 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,939 | $1,285 | $3,041 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Nashville
How much are Studio apartments in Nashville?
There are currently 6 Studio Apartments in Nashville with rent ranges from $608 to $849 with an average price of $718.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Nashville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Nashville ranges from $615 to $1,596 with an average monthly rent of $884.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Nashville c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Nashville range from $660 to $2,077.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,074.
How expensive are Nashville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 19 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Nashville on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$925 to $2,364 - averaging $1,307 for the location.
